Roasted Chicken Breast at 400

An easy 3 ingredient method for roasting juicy chicken breast that's perfect for dinner, salads, sandwiches, bowls, and more.

Ingredients
  

  • 1.5 lb Chicken breast
  • 1.5 tablespoon All purpose seasoning I used a blend of salt, pepper, onion & garlic powders, and paprika
  • 1 tablespoon oil of choice, I used avocado oil

Instructions
 

  • Preheat oven to 400°F (205°C). Line a rimmed baking sheet with parchment paper.
  • Pound chicken to an even thickness (focus on the thick end).
  • Rub chicken with oil, then coat both sides with seasoning. Place on the pan.
  • Bake 18 to 22 minutes, depending on thickness. Check the thickest part with an instant read thermometer. Pull at 160°F.
  • Rest chicken breast, transferring to a plate once it hits 165°F. After 5-10 minutes, slice against the grain and serve.

Notes

  • Don’t skip flattening. Even thickness prevents the thin end from drying out.
  • Thermometer = best results. Color is not a reliable doneness check for chicken breast.
  • Carryover cooking matters. Pulling at 160°F plus resting lands you at 165°F without overcooking.
  • If it’s under 160°F: return to oven and recheck every 1 to 3 minutes.
  • Avoid overcooking on the pan: move chicken off the hot baking sheet once it hits temp.
  • Seasoning swaps: Use any chicken seasoning blend you like (Italian, Cajun, taco, lemon pepper).
  • Storage: Cool, then refrigerate airtight for up to 4 days. Great for salads, wraps, bowls, and meal prep.
